Umno Youth Tasked With Seeking Ideas From Young Generation: Can they?

PUTRAJAYA, Feb 17 (Bernama) -- The Umno Youth movement will hold meetings with the young generation to seek ideas on tackling current issues and find out their 'wish list' with regard to government policies.
Umno Youth head Khairy Jamaluddin said the movement had been asked to do so by Prime Minister Datuk Seri Najib Tun Razak so that the ideas and aspirations of the young generation could be conveyed to and subsequently acted upon by the government.
"The era of the government knowing everything is over. Government does not know anything, so the Umno Youth is tasked with seeking from the young generation who are not necessarily members of Umno, the Youth wing or Barisan Nasional (BN), what are their requests and wishes from the government," he told reporters after leading a courtesy call by the Umno Youth Exco on the Prime Minister, here Wednesday.
Khairy said the movement had already performed this task at the various levels previously but the implementation had not been systematic as desired by the Prime Minister.
He said a meeting would be held later for the setting up of a committee to monitor the formation of a special laboratory to carry out the task and the first report was expected to be presented within three months.
In addition, he said the movement would also launch the 1Malaysia Youth Expedition next month to explain the concept of 1Malaysia to the young generation throughout the country.
Asked whether the delegation discussed speculations on developments in Umno Youth, Khairy said the issue did not arise, adding that it was a normal meeting to discuss the direction of the movement in assisting the people, especially the young generation and not a meeting to resolve the movement's internal crisis.
"In terms of politics, Datuk Seri Najib was satisfied with the direction of the Umno Youth currently and he had stressed that solidarity was crucial not only in Umno Youth but also the Umno party as a whole and the BN," he said.
